On Saturday, April 25th, check out an artist whose dream is and has always been completely indulged with music. Erica Rebinski is performing at The Asylum in Lewisburg, WV at 9pm. She will be accompanied by acoustic blues/soul rock performer, Wesley Cash (pictured below).

Erica’s interest in music is not limited to one kind and she loves all genres. her focus is mostly on a country pop fusion with a flare of her own. Currently she is working on writing originals and her current cover song lists include but are not limited to artists such as Carrie Underwood, Kelly Clarkson, LeAnn Rimes, and Jason Mraz. When Wesley was 8 years old, he began playing fiddle in a bluegrass band and began training in classical violin. Every Sunday, he would deliver the gift of music to local nursing homes. As he got older, he ventured from violin to saxophone to bass and eventually guitar, harmonica and a little bit of percussion. He started writing at around 15 years old and was mostly influenced by Love, his high school crushes. Wesley became serious in music at 27 when he moved to Los Angeles and played various shows around the city for several months. This adventure wet his palat and after a short stint in Kentucky, Wesley found himself in Nashville trying to break into the scene. And the rest has yet to be written.. HASHTAGWV ART & ENTERTAINMENT Publisher/Editor-in-Chief, Christina Entenmann-Edwards has been a WV resident since September 2008. She was born and raised in Fairfield County, Connecticut, and is no stranger to hard work and the entrepreneurial spirit. In 2006, she graduated from Quinnipiac University (Hamden, Connecticut), Cum Laude, with a B.A. in History. In 2010, she graduated with an M.B.A. from Liberty University (Lynchburg, Virginia). In February 2012, Christina launched HashtagWV as the area’s first full-color, free arts and entertainment tabloid + online platform. Christina completed the Leadership West Virginia class of 2021, which is an innovative program that grows, engages, and mobilizes leaders to ignite a life passion to move West Virginia forward.
